What you will do
Champions and adheres to Worldwide’s Quality Management System (QMS).
Participates in the crafting of the QA organizational goals and objectives as assigned.
Mentors a team of Quality professionals and ensures quality deliverables, on time, and in compliance with regulations and Worldwide processes for all Audit & Inspection activities.
Oversees, monitors, and reports for internal and external QA audits to ensure timely completion of applicable CAPAs to prevent reoccurrence and to drive process improvements.
Develops and drives continuous process improvements.
Participates in the development and review of Quality Management Documents.
Assists with tracking and reporting of Key Quality Indications (KQI) and Quality Tolerance Limits (QTL) for the Audit & Inspection Program.
Assists with performance of QA audits for Vendors, Internal Process, Clinical Investigator, Document and other audits as assigned.
Manages, plans, hosts, reports, documentation and follow up of all Worldwide Sponsor audits.
Serves as a core member on the Global Regulatory Inspection Team for all Regulatory Inspections of Worldwide.
Provides support to Sponsors Inspections in relation to Worldwide provided services.
Serves as a Subject Matter Expert on QA Quality Management processes for Audits and Inspections.
